首页
学习
活动
专区
圈层
工具
发布
首页
学习
活动
专区
圈层
工具
MCP广场
社区首页 >问答首页 >Android仿真器屏幕大小与设备帧不相同

Android仿真器屏幕大小与设备帧不相同
EN

Stack Overflow用户
提问于 2017-05-16 23:31:46
回答 4查看 12.9K关注 0票数 12

当我运行模拟器时,屏幕大小比设备帧小,如下面的图像所示。这种情况只发生在屏幕分辨率为3840x2160的计算机上。

EN

回答 4

Stack Overflow用户

回答已采纳

发布于 2020-09-17 07:49:31

THis肯定会工作

在使用硬件呈现时,您可以通过简单地使windows覆盖缩放设置来解决缩放问题。怎么做?,这很容易。只需找到您正在使用的模拟器的.exe文件(例如,"qemu-system-armel.exe“用于ARM,"qemu-system-x86_64.exe”用于x86)。要确定哪个.exe文件正在运行,只需运行模拟器,然后使用任务管理器来定位正在运行的.exe文件,请参见屏幕截图。使用任务管理器定位.exe文件

在我的例子中,它位于这个位置:"C:\UsersUsername\AppData\Local\Android\Sdk\emulator\qemu\windows-x86_64\qemu-system-x86_64.exe"

现在,只需右键单击文件,然后单击属性,然后选择“兼容性”选项卡。在底部的“设置”下,单击“更改新闻部的高设置”。一扇新的窗户会打开。勾选最后一个复选框“覆盖高DPI缩放行为”。在“高新闻部缩放覆盖”下。然后从它下面的下拉列表中选择"System“(这是非常重要的,否则不会有任何区别!),请看下面的截图。现在点击OK和OK。重启Android,就这样,问题解决了:)

票数 16
EN

Stack Overflow用户

发布于 2017-06-13 16:02:15

我有一个戴尔XPS 13的屏幕分辨率为3200 x 1800,我有完全相同的问题。

在播放这些设置之后,我在Android中找到了一个(临时)解决方案:

导航到Tools -> Android -> AVD管理器

  1. 点击“编辑这个AVD”(用铅笔画的那个)
  2. 在“模拟性能”中单击“软件..”选项(下图)

这样,渲染是由软件,而不是从图形卡。它肯定会影响性能,但也许对测试来说是可以的。

替代建议:--我测试了来自基因运动的仿真器,它可以工作。这是免费的个人用户,也许是一个好的选择,如果你想要更快的东西。

票数 8
EN

Stack Overflow用户

发布于 2019-11-19 19:33:38

我能够通过在Surface上解决这个问题,方法是进入显示设置(右击桌面并选择),并将比例从150%更改为100%。

规模设置:

这个设置使得所有的窗口和文本都变小了,我不用放大镜就可以看到,所以我把它改回150%,这个问题没有再次出现。

票数 4
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/44013216

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档